What would happen if we continued to overharvest swordfish?

Answer:

Overharvesting fish depletes some species to very low numbers and drives others to extinction. In practical terms, it reduces valuable living resources to such low levels that their exploitation is no longer sustainable.

Overharvesting swordfish could cause their extinction and mess up the food chain, harming (starving) their predators.
